2. Cookies and external services
Our website may use cookies.
Cookies are data records that are stored in your browser by the website or server when you visit the website and are sent back to the server each time you access the website. Cookies allow data (e.g. language settings, shopping cart contents, login status, etc.) to be stored between page views or recurring visits in your browser. This means that the browser remembers the settings from your last visit.
Cookies can also be used to uniquely identify your browser. This can be used, among other things, to verify your authorization (login status).
We use only so-called essential cookies that are necessary for operating the website and its functions. These cookies cannot be declined. This may include functions such as language settings, shopping cart of an online shop, cookies to check login status, and similar cookies. These cookies are not used to track visitors. Most of these cookies are automatically deleted after the browser is closed (session cookies).
